Largely pushed by demand from Ukrainian migrant workers, LOT is increasing flights from Kharkiv and Warsaw to 11 times a week. At the same time, the Polish carrier is talking with Kharkiv about adding two more destinations — Poznan and Wroclaw — Vladyslav Ilyin, commercial director of Kharkiv International Airport, tells Interfax-Ukraine.
